How Tadley compares
Small towns rarely get published solar figures, so here are the numbers for Tadley. It is one of 45 Hampshire towns we track, and it ranks 39th of 45 for solar yield, a town of 14,985 people in the House of Commons Library settlement data. PVGIS gives its roofs 1,032 kWh per kWp a year, 2.83 peak sun hours a day averaged across the seasons, and the standard 12 panel model turns that into £922 of year one benefit, £247 of it from your own generation and £675 from export at 12p.
Treat these as calibration rather than a quote. The calculator below runs the same model, defaulted to Tadley's own yield, and at Tadley's 1,032 kWh per kWp it prices a 12 panel system at £6,360 installed before any battery. A 12 panel, 6.36 kWp system in Tadley generates around 6,564 kWh a year, worth around £922 in year one on the 12p export scenario.
Generation is modelled from PVGIS satellite data for Tadley's own coordinates (51.35653, -1.14326), using the same 26.32p/kWh import value and £1,000 per kWp installed pricing as every Clearline estimate, with the full methodology, sourcing and assumptions set out on our help page.

Would a system in Tadley need a G99 application?
Most home solar and battery systems qualify for the simpler G98 notification, made to the network operator (DNO) after installation rather than before. A minority, usually larger systems, need the fuller G99 process instead. Read the guide →How Tadley compares with its neighbours
Same satellite dataset, same assumptions, so the differences are real geography rather than modelling noise.
| Town | kWh per kWp | Peak sun hours | vs Tadley |
|---|---|---|---|
| Tadley | 1,032 | 2.83 | — |
| Thatcham | 1,025 | 2.81 | -7 kWh |
| Basingstoke | 1,031 | 2.83 | -1 kWh |
| Newbury | 1,034 | 2.83 | +2 kWh |
| Reading | 1,028 | 2.82 | -4 kWh |
| Hook (Hart) | 1,036 | 2.84 | +4 kWh |
| Caversham | 1,025 | 2.81 | -7 kWh |
PVGIS v5.2 for each town centroid, identical assumptions throughout. A few kWh either way is weather-year noise; a spread beyond about 30 kWh per kWp is real geography.
